Botano Health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Botano Health in the United States is $86,198.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$41. Salaries at Botano Health typically range from $75,947 to $97,307 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Botano Health
Together with our clients, we are working to improve quality of life while protecting our environment. Studies show that about one-third of the food produced in the world is lost due to insect and fungus damage. What Is the Cost of Living Near Memphis?

Understanding the cost of living near Memphis is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Botano Health.
Memphis' Cost of Living Index is approximately 79.8 (20.2% less expensive than US average; 11.5% less than TN average). Blues/BBQ, FedEx hub, very affordable housing. MATA bus/trolley. When planning your budget based on a salary from Botano Health,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$850 - $1,300+ A significant portion of Botano Health sal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(MATA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$660+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,130 - $3,410+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
